AnnMarie Keleher
February 10, 1938 - September 16, 2020
AnnMarie Keleher, 82, longtime resident of Haverhill, passed away peacefully on September 16, 2020 at the Baker-Katz Nursing and Rehabilitation Center. She was born on February 10, 1938 to the late Mary (Maloney) Keleher in Lawrence and attended St. Mary’s High School, graduating with the Class of 1956. Believing in the value of a secondary education, AnnMarie attended Emmanuel and Merrimack Colleges, obtaining her degree in accounting. After college, she worked for several local businesses as an accountant and finished her career at Lawrence Public Schools in the payroll department. A lifelong Catholic, AnnMarie was a communicant at St. Mary’s Church in Lawrence. She enjoyed many of life’s simple pleasures; spending time with family and friends, crafts and reading. AnnMarie is survived by her sister JoAnne Shertzer and her husband Robert of Lancaster, PA. She is also survived by her nephews; Robert Shertzer and his wife Staci, also of Lancaster, PA and Joseph Maloney and his wife Mary Beth of Methuen as well as several cousins. She is predeceased by her brother, William A. Keleher of Dallas, TX. To honor AnnMarie’s wishes, all services were privately held.
